I would agree with oddjob that a CB-2 is really only worth $125-150 in good working order with good paint. With minor issues and chipped paint $100. These were pretty basic commuters and the bike is likely 25-30 years old not 15 most of these were sold 1988-1991. This the sales photo for the 1988.

Good lord, to me that's a $50 bike, even with the Bridgestone Tax. The CB series are just low end mountain bikes branded as city commuters. A $150 offer is still Stumpjumper money to me. Please wait for something nicer and less crazily-priced.
